Description:"Complete Blue Note 45 Sessions" on CD brings together the legendary 7-inch single recordings that tenor saxophonist Ike Quebec created for the Blue Note label in the early 1960s. These sessions capture Quebec's warm, breathy tone in compact, groove-oriented arrangements that were originally designed for jukeboxes and radio play. The compilation focuses on soulful, blues-infused hard bop and early soul-jazz, featuring medium-tempo shuffles, late-night ballads, and earthy, swinging tunes that highlight both his expressive ballad style and his punchy, rhythmic phrasing on faster numbers. Carefully remastered for CD, the collection offers a cohesive listening experience that preserves the intimate club atmosphere and analog warmth of the original 45s while presenting them in a convenient, comprehensive format.

Ike Quebec was a prominent tenor saxophonist of the classic jazz era, known for his rich, husky sound, lyrical phrasing, and deep connection to the blues. Active from the swing era into the 1960s, he collaborated with numerous leading jazz figures and contributed both as a sideman and as a leader. His work for Blue Note, particularly in his later years, has earned enduring respect among jazz listeners for its emotional depth, strong melodic sense, and unhurried, vocal-like delivery on ballads. Quebec's recordings from this period are often cited as some of the most soulful tenor performances in the Blue Note catalog, and this CD highlights exactly that side of his artistry.
